development (dɪˈvɛləpmənt) [Click for IPA pronunciation guide]
 
n
1.  the act or process of growing, progressing, or developing
2.  the product or result of developing
3.  a fact, event, or happening, esp one that changes a situation
4.  an area or tract of land that has been developed
5.  Also called: development section the section of a movement, usually in sonata form, in which the basic musical themes are developed
6.  chess
 a.  the process of developing pieces
 b.  the manner in which they are developed
 c.  the position of the pieces in the early part of a game with reference to their attacking potential or defensive efficiency
